My yard in Cedar Rapids has drainage problems. Can lawn care services actually help with that?
Absolutely. While severe issues may require dedicated grading or drainage systems, foundational lawn care is crucial for improving water absorption. Our services include core aeration, which relieves soil compaction—a common cause of pooling water in Iowa lawns. This allows rainwater to penetrate deeper into the soil rather than running off or creating soggy patches. Combined with proper mowing heights and balanced fertilization, we promote a thicker, healthier lawn that acts like a sponge, effectively mitigating minor to moderate drainage issues.
